United States Green Building Council developed the Leadership in Energy
and Environmental Design (LEED) Green Building Rating System™ which is the
nationally accepted benchmark for the design, construction, and operation of
high performance green buildings. LEED gives building owners and operators
the tools they need to have an immediate and measurable impact on their
buildings’ performance. LEED promotes a whole-building approach to
sustainability by recognizing performance in five key areas of human and
environmental health: sustainable site development, water savings, energy
efficiency, materials selection, and indoor environmental quality.
To earn certification, a building project must meet certain prerequisites
and performance benchmarks ("credits") within each category. Projects are
awarded Certified, Silver, Gold, or Platinum certification depending on the
number of credits they achieve. This comprehensive approach is the reason
LEED-certified buildings have reduced operating costs, provided for
healthier and more productive occupants, and helped conserve our natural
resources. |

Conforms to or exceeds all applicable IBC
codes. In addition to the mentioned tests, methods, and
results, the material is in agreement with IBC Sections
1504.6 (impact resistance), Sound Transmission Section 1206,
Fire Partitions Section 708, and Fire Resistance Section
705.
